Irene Whattoff

May 12, 1917 — December 30, 2013

Irene J. Whattoff, 96, a resident of the Plano-Dallas area for 11 years, died December 30, 2013. Visitation will be from 10:15 AM until 11:00 AM at Prestonwood Baptist Church-Dallas Campus, 12123 Hillcrest Rd., Dallas, Texas 75230 with the funeral service to follow at 11:00 AM. Graveside service and burial will be in Ames, Iowa on January 4, 2013.
Irene was born May 12, 1917 in Stuart, Iowa to Fred and Clara (Robertson) Downs. She was one of 12 children born in this marriage and was the last survivor of the 12. She was a graduate of Ames High School and married Vernard Whattoff on May 30, 1941. She was a devout wife to Vernard until he preceded her in death in 2003.
She was a long time member of Campus Baptist Church in Ames. She and Vernard were dedicated to reaching the international students that were attending the university in Ames. Together they impacted hundreds of students and others in their outreach and ministry. After their move to Plano, they regularly attended Prestonwood Baptist Church where Irene assisted in grading Bible study homework for the prison ministry. At age 92, she received an award as the oldest volunteer from Prestonwood to assist in this ministry. God surely welcomed her into His presence with "Well done, good and faithful servant."
Irene is survived by four loving children, Mary (Robert) Hamm of Plano, Robert (Debbie) Whattoff of Savoy, IL, Karen (Jon) Anders of Dallas, and David Whattoff of Dallas. She also leaves grandchildren and respective spouse Matthew Hamm, Marc Hamm, Krista Michel, Natalie Adair, Mason Anders, Joe Whattoff, Brittney Anders, and Grant Anders. There are also six great-grandchildren surviving.
